  1. Gerald Scarfe was born on 1 June 1936 in St John's Wood, London, the son of Reginald Scarfe, a City banker, and his wife Dorothy, a teacher. As a child Scarfe suffered severely from asthma, and spent a lot of time in bed, being frequently in hospital - "a very lonely childhood" he recalled.

  5. Gerald Anthony Scarfe (born 1 June 1936) is an English cartoonist and illustrator. He has worked as editorial cartoonist for The Sunday Times and illustrator for The New Yorker.. His other work includes graphics for rock group Pink Floyd, particularly on their 1979 album The Wall, its 1982 film adaptation, and tour (1980–81), as well as the music video for "Welcome to the Machine".
